LOS ANGELES -- The Chargers informed running back Gus Edwards that they will release him, a source told ESPN's Adam Schefter on Friday. Edwards' release saves the Chargers $3.125 million against ...
Edwards' release saves the Chargers $3.125 million against the salary cap. The Chargers signed Edwards to a two-year deal last offseason, hoping he could play a significant role in the running game.
